Your Cleaning Arsenal

Before you dive in, you need the right tools, just like a chef needs their knives. Here's what you'll need:

  • All-purpose cleaner: This is your go-to for most surfaces, like a Swiss Army knife for cleaning.
  • Glass cleaner: Makes windows and mirrors sparkle, like magic!
  • Disinfectant cleaner: Essential for bathrooms, kitchens, and anywhere you want to kill germs.
  • Bleach: Powerful stuff for tackling mold and mildew, but use it carefully! Always read the label first.
  • Microfiber cloths: Soft and absorbent, perfect for dusting and wiping things down.
  • Sponges: For washing dishes and scrubbing surfaces.
  • Scrub brushes: For those tough stains in the bathroom and kitchen.
  • Vacuum cleaner: For keeping carpets and floors clean, it's a must-have!
  • Mop and bucket: For mopping floors.
  • Dustpan and brush: For sweeping up dirt and debris.
  • Garbage bags: For throwing away trash.
  • Rubber gloves: Protect your hands from harsh chemicals and grime.

Room-by-Room Cleaning Guide

1. Kitchen

The kitchen is the heart of the home, but it can get messy fast. Here's how to tackle it:

  1. Clear the clutter: Start by taking everything off the counters and sink.
  2. Wash the dishes: Wash those dirty dishes, either by hand or using the dishwasher.
  3. Clean the sink: Scrub the sink with all-purpose cleaner and a sponge. Make it sparkle!
  4. Wipe down countertops: Use all-purpose cleaner and a microfiber cloth to wipe down countertops, backsplash, and appliances.
  5. Clean the stovetop: Remove the burner grates and clean them with a scrub brush and soapy water. Wipe down the stovetop with all-purpose cleaner.
  6. Clean the oven: If your oven is self-cleaning, use that feature. Otherwise, use a commercial oven cleaner or a mix of baking soda and water.
  7. Clean the microwave: Fill a bowl with water and a few tablespoons of vinegar. Microwave it on high for a few minutes, let it sit, then wipe down the inside.
  8. Clean the refrigerator: Take out all the food and throw away anything that's expired. Wipe down the shelves and drawers with all-purpose cleaner.
  9. Empty the trash: Take out the trash and replace the bag.
  10. Sweep or mop the floor: Sweep or mop the floor with a cleaning solution.

2. Bathroom

The bathroom needs regular cleaning because of all the moisture. Here's how to keep it sparkling clean:

  1. Clean the toilet: Use a toilet bowl cleaner and a toilet brush to scrub the bowl. Don't forget to clean the outside of the toilet, too.
  2. Clean the sink: Scrub the sink with all-purpose cleaner and a sponge. Clean the faucet and handles as well.
  3. Clean the bathtub or shower: Spray the tub or shower with disinfectant cleaner, let it sit, then scrub with a brush and rinse. If your showerhead is clogged, soak it in vinegar overnight to remove mineral deposits.
  4. Clean the mirror: Spray the mirror with glass cleaner and wipe it down with a microfiber cloth.
  5. Wipe down the walls and floor: Use all-purpose cleaner and a microfiber cloth to wipe down the walls and floor.
  6. Empty the trash: Take out the trash and replace the bag.

3. Bedroom

Your bedroom should be a relaxing place, so keep it clean and organized. Here's how:

  1. Make the bed: Start by making the bed. It instantly makes the room look neater.
  2. Pick up clothes: Gather any dirty laundry and put it in a hamper.
  3. Dust surfaces: Use a microfiber cloth to dust furniture, shelves, and other surfaces.
  4. Vacuum or sweep the floor: Vacuum or sweep the floor to remove dust and debris.
  5. Organize your closet: Get rid of any clutter and put away clothes you don't wear anymore. Use storage bins to keep things organized.
  6. Empty the trash: Take out the trash and replace the bag.

4. Living Room

The living room is where you spend time with family and friends, so keep it clean and welcoming.

  1. Clear the clutter: Remove any clutter from coffee tables, end tables, and shelves. Put things back where they belong.
  2. Dust surfaces: Use a microfiber cloth to dust furniture, shelves, and other surfaces.
  3. Vacuum or sweep the floor: Vacuum or sweep the floor to remove dust and debris.
  4. Clean windows and mirrors: Spray windows and mirrors with glass cleaner and wipe them down with a microfiber cloth.
  5. Empty the trash: Take out the trash and replace the bag.

5. Entryway

The entryway is the first thing people see when they come to your apartment, so make it inviting.

  1. Wipe down the doormat: Shake out or vacuum the doormat to remove dirt and debris.
  2. Hang up coats and bags: Place coats and bags on hangers or in a designated storage area.
  3. Wipe down surfaces: Use all-purpose cleaner and a microfiber cloth to wipe down the entryway table, shelves, and other surfaces.
  4. Sweep or vacuum the floor: Sweep or vacuum the floor to remove dirt and debris.
  5. Empty the trash: Take out the trash and replace the bag.

Cleaning Tips and Tricks

Here are some extra tips to make cleaning easier:

  • Declutter regularly: Don't let clutter build up. Put things away as you go.
  • Clean as you go: Don't let dishes pile up in the sink or laundry pile up in the basket. Clean as you go to prevent things from getting out of control.
  • Utilize storage solutions: Use shelves, drawers, bins, and other storage solutions to maximize space.
  • Clean from top to bottom: Start by cleaning the ceiling and work your way down to the floor so dust doesn't fall onto already cleaned surfaces.
  • Use natural cleaning solutions: Try using vinegar, baking soda, and lemon juice instead of harsh chemicals.
  • Don't forget the appliances: Clean your refrigerator, oven, microwave, and dishwasher regularly to prevent buildup and keep them working well.
  • Air out your apartment: Open windows and doors to let fresh air circulate.
  • Clean regularly: Don't wait until your apartment is super messy to clean. Clean regularly to prevent dirt and grime from building up.
